those are swirls from the sander. Some very deep ugly swirls btw.. newbie you might want to check that.

The OP sanded thru to the gelcoat not thru the gelcoat.

Ideally, paint with barrier epoxy. Is it imperative..No. But its the right thing to do.

My guess is the boat probably has some dings on the keel that could stand some epoxy filler and then barrier coat too.
So might as well get some barrier paint. It takes time between coats(a day) and thats a pain when you are only touching up spots

If you are trying to get launched quickly, blow it off and do it "someday"
